Output f4ccbb16a42174a65c35daaeef51a148433ec27aab735ae9467a65d9af0085c4:3

value
266037606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9999df89596346bf38c4dfe2fc0aff0e11f8a8 OP_EQUAL
address
MSYz5xDbtMcwUcT5oj7mgyLVs2Ff4Jx68j
transaction
f4ccbb16a42174a65c35daaeef51a148433ec27aab735ae9467a65d9af0085c4
spent
true